Germany has jailed Lutheran Pastor Johannes Lerle for comparing abortion to the Nazi Holocaust. Life Site—A city court in Erlangen, Bavaria, gave Lutheran Pastor Johannes Lerle a one year jail sentence for the “crime” of comparing abortion to the Nazi holocaust.
